WitrynaAs many as 40% of community-dwelling older individuals may be chronically underhydrated. 1 For those experiencing swallowing difficulties, staying hydrated can be even more difficult. The consequences can be dire. Older adults with dehydration can experience confusion, falls, a reduced ability to fight infection, and even death. 2 In … Witryna30 mar 2024 · Improving hydration for care home residents Preventing dehydration in care homes for older people is a pressing concern for the social care sector, as it can lead to unnecessary hospital...

If you or someone you care for is having trouble getting proper nutrition, here are some practical tips. Malnutrition and Older Adults Witryna11 wrz 2024 · 2.1 Recommendations for Older Adults. Generally, an adequate intake (AI) of fluid for older adults is defined as 2.0 L/day for women and 2.5 L/day for men [ 6, 9 ]. Assuming 20% of fluids come from eating foods, this means women need at least 1.6 L/day of drinks and men 2.0 L/day.
